Children's Art Classes in Jacksonville offers summer art workshops for kids where campers can choose up to four workshops each week, spanning clay, painting, charcoal, stained glass, mask making, and drawing, all taught by certified instructors. It also runs school-year art classes. It is a local studio operating within the national Children's Art Classes brand.
